Understanding Gorelocker Machines
Gorelocker Machines are a vital part of the round duct - making industry. They are primarily used to fabricate elbows and other curved components for HVAC (Heating, Ventilation, and Air Conditioning) systems. These machines work by bending and forming metal sheets into the desired shapes, such as spiral elbows or beaded elbows.

Precision Requirements in High - Precision Tasks
High - precision tasks in the HVAC industry demand a high level of accuracy in terms of dimensions, angles, and surface finish. For example, in a large - scale commercial HVAC project, the elbows need to fit together perfectly to ensure smooth air flow. Any deviation in the dimensions or angles can lead to air leakage, reduced efficiency, and increased energy consumption.
In addition, the surface finish of the elbows is also important. A rough surface can cause turbulence in the air flow, which can also affect the performance of the HVAC system. Therefore, high - precision tasks require machines that can produce components with tight tolerances and a smooth surface finish.

Limitations and Considerations
While our Gorelocker Machines are capable of high - precision tasks, there are some limitations and considerations.
The material being used can have an impact on the precision of the components. Different metals have different properties, such as hardness and ductility. For example, stainless steel is more difficult to form than mild steel, and it may require more precise control of the forming process.
The complexity of the design also plays a role. Highly complex elbow designs may require more advanced programming and setup of the machine. In some cases, additional manual operations may be needed to achieve the desired precision.
